Police Car Collides with Elderly Woman

Summary by tv2kosmopol.dk
An elderly woman had to be freed from her car after she was hit by a police car, Chief of Police Lee Skeen from the North Zealand Police told TV 2. The accident happened around 2:15 p.m. in Helsinge, where the patrol car was on its way to an assignment. The woman ignored her unconditional duty to give way and drove in front of the police car. No one was injured in the collision.
